It’s all about Buttercream today folks!

It is one of my favorite things to make, and it is not as hard as you may think. All it takes is a little patience. One of my favorite buttercream’s to make is Italian Buttercream, you can’t go wrong with it. It’s definitely my go to buttercream when I am decorating or frosting a cake.

It is not greasy, heavy or overly sweet. It’s perfect.
